All,

We would like  to schedule  a time on a Saturday, sometime in the next few 
weeks, to  test our BWD-90 NVIS  antenna at different heights at our EOC to 
see  
what the best height off the  ground would be for operating 40 meters  
sometime 
in the afternoon (maybe 3 PM?).  We want to try to call a few  stations 
around 
Maryland, then move the antenna  higher, then call the  same stations again, 
then move the antenna higher, etc. to  see what  works best for reaching both 
near 
and far stations in Maryland. Then,   we would like to perform the same test 
on 80 meters in the evening of the  same  day.
